Atlas Copco to re-brand Krupp ready for Bauma
Atlas Copco has said that the integration of its recently purchased
Krupp brand of hydraulic attachments will be completed in time for
the Bauma exhibition in 2004.
"We will have re-branded the range as Atlas Copco by then," said
senior executive vice-president Bj"rn Rosengren.
"The combination of the two brands is a perfect match. Atlas Copco
is very strong in the small sizes, while Krupp has the reputation
in medium to large units," said Rosengren, adding that the purchase
had made Atlas Copco the market leader in hydraulic breakers.
The company also plans to introduce a four-model range of rotating
demolition pulverisers in January of next year, as well as two new
hydraulic breakers made for scaling.
Another area Atlas Copco is hoping to exploit further is surface
mining, which now accounts for 94% of mining activity. "We're very
strong in underground mines, but less so in surface mining which
has good potential for us," said Rosengren.
